Kenya Manley is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ker. She earned a Bachelor of Social work from Morehead State University and a Master of Science in Social Work from the University of Louisville. Kenya has 8 years of experience working in the community and in corrections. She provides services to individuals via telehealth. As a neurodivergent person herself Kenya understands how draining it can be to find a therapist that is the right match for you. She believes individuals should be encouraged to advocate for themselves and their symptoms while being provided psychoeducation along the way. Kenya is a firm believer in reframing your thought patterns and setting healthy boundaries but realizes this can be an uncomfortable process. She utilizes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Mindfulness, Socratic Questioning and Motivational Interviewing to assist in developing your own individualized path to a balanced life.
